Why Do Ingrown Toenails Hurt So Much?

An ingrown toenail occurs when the sharp corner of your toenail grows into the soft skin of the toe. The body recognizes this as a "foreign object," like a splinter, and launches an inflammatory response. This causes:

  • Pain and Tenderness: Especially when pressure is applied from shoes or even a bedsheet.
  • Redness and Swelling: The area becomes inflamed as the body tries to fight the "invader."
  • Infection: The break in the skin provides an entry point for bacteria, leading to pus, drainage, and increased pain. If left untreated, the infection can become serious.

Causes of Ingrown Toenails

  • Improper Trimming: Cutting your toenails too short or rounding the corners is the most common cause. Nails should be cut straight across.
  • Tight Footwear: Shoes or socks that crowd the toes can push the nail into the skin.
  • Nail Shape: Some people have naturally curved (incurvated) nails that make them more prone to the condition.
  • Injury: Stubbing your toe or dropping something on it can lead to an ingrown nail.

The Definitive Solution: A Painless In-Office Procedure

While home remedies like soaking might help in the very earliest stages, the only definitive cure for a moderate to severe ingrown toenail is a minor surgical procedure performed by a specialist.

Here's what to expect at our clinic:

  1. Local Anesthesia: Dr. Gautam will administer a small injection to completely numb the toe. You will not feel any pain during the procedure.
  2. Partial Nail Removal: The ingrown portion of the nail is carefully and precisely removed. The healthy part of the nail is left untouched.
  3. Permanent Correction (Matrixectomy): For recurring ingrown nails, a chemical is applied to the nail root in that corner to prevent that small section from ever growing back, solving the problem for good. This procedure is detailed on our Ingrown Toenail Surgery page.
